近十余年来
对于环-磷酸鸟苷(cGMP)在中枢神经系统中的机能作用引起了人们的注意.有报导 cGMP 具有镇痛性质
并假设 cGMP 或许是一种或一种以上的神经递质的调节者。本工作是观察脑室注射cGMP 对针刺镇痛的影响
并探索它与乙酰胆碱及阿片样物质之间可能存在的关系.The purpose of this study is to observe the effects of intraventricular injection(IVT)of cGMP on acupuncture analgesia(AA)and its relationship with acetylcholine and endogenous opiate like substances.The following results have been obtained. 1.After the intraventricular injection of cGMP(400μg)pain thresho- lds of rats were markedly elevated (47%~63%).During continuous electro- acupuncture for thirty minutes
the average pain threshold increased by 47%.Intraventicular injection of cGMP associated with additional electro- acupuncture elevated markedly Pain thresholds(130%).The effect was more that of arithmetic sum of cGMP plus electro-acupuncture.These results indicated that cGMP enhanced the effects of AA. 2.The effects of AA decreased by 18% at 3 hours after IVT of hemi- cholinium-3(50μg).On the basis of that
cGMP raised the effects of AA by 42%
but the effect failed to reach the original level.The result suggested that the enhancement of cGMP on AA could be partially antagonized by hemicholinium-3. 3.The effect of AA of rats could not be blocked by the IVT of naloxone(30μg).When cGMP was used in combination with naloxone
the reenforce effect of cGMP on AA was not shown.The results suggested that the enhancement action of cGMP on AA could be antagonized by bloc- king the opiate receptor with naloxone.
